Transaction 3c91884145da83877270a65f99925f5368e6338ab2184bc73832f7274ba0d01e
1 Input
1 Output
-
3c91884145da83877270a65f99925f5368e6338ab2184bc73832f7274ba0d01e:0
- value
- 392737
- script pubkey
- OP_0 OP_PUSHBYTES_20 238af09bed87fedfa96d8f50e5c478c19aed28af
- address
- bc1qyw90pxldslldl2td3agwt3rccxdw62905pfehw